DemandZEN is a U.S.-based B2B demand generation and outsourced SDR agency that specializes in outbound lead generation, appointment setting, and account-based marketing for technology companies.

Objective UI is a full-funnel marketing agency specializing in driving qualified traffic, generating leads, and increasing sales for small to mid-sized businesses. They focus on understanding customer journeys to deliver the right message at the right time.
